VE0 531T - 1979 Ascona Modified

Owner: Nick Hayward a.k.a. Ferret

I bought this car for £400 taxed + tested and drove it back from Manchester in November 2001.

The car has been treated with Ziebart at some point, so is surprisingly solid underneath!

UPDATED 01/07

I restored and drove this fine vehicle for a couple of years, but decided to sell it when I started uni as I was going to be skint for three years and I didn’t want to neglect it.

It went to another retro nut, who has taken it even further with vinyl graphics and more mods.

I miss this car dearly, even when it always had a flat battery because it didn’t have a “lights on” warning buzzer. And I miss scraping the front arches every time I went round a corner, and the noise, and the stress of finding LRP.

And the rust.

Engine & drivetrain

120bhp rebuilt 2.0S engine
Twin choke Weber
K&N
Proper Braided hoses
5 speed box
Back axle off a 1.8 Manta
Viscous coupled fan

Suspension

70mm drop Jamex springs
Gabriel shocks

Brakes

Grooved disks
Reconned twin pot callipers
Mintex road pads (Tried 1144 compound but they squealed)
Goodridge braided hoses
Rear drum brakes all replaced

Interior

Standard retro seats and dash
Custom Solutions ally window winders
Momo Ally and leather gear knob

 

Bodywork

Bumpers removed
Side mouldings, pins, badges etc removed
Rear door handles smoothed
Passenger side de-locked
Chrome trims removed from gutters
Windscreen de-chromed
Ariel hole smoothed
Headlight washer and spotlight wiring removed
Trick transponder Immobiliser
Clear front indicators
Front grille de-chromed

Most of the work on the car was done by Clive from Custom Solutions and Edley from Fast and Funky motors. This car cost me a lot of money as I replaced nearly everything on it - the original stuff was;

(a) 25 years old
(b) crap anyway.
